My sweet Raleigh turned three yesterday and here is the card I made him. It's based on his favorite monster truck, Max D.
I started with the kraft paper with Itty Bitty Backgrounds "dirt" stamped all over it. Then I took one of the kids' monster trucks, inked up its wheels and drove all over the paper. That was fun. This week's sketch was perfect for this card because I could make the stripe to match the stripe on the Max D truck that kind of looks like flames. So I used a variation of the camouflage background technique. I crumpled up the yellow cardstock and rubbed Cantaloupe and Tangelo ink all over it. Then I printed out the sweet Monster Truck digi from PrettyGrafikDesign and cut it with my ScanNCut. Mounted him on a silver square that I drew in some tire tracks. Finished off with a banner with three flags and a three stamped on it. I made sure to distress a lot because I'm on the "Shabby Chic" TLC Challenge (#11).
